Pittsburgh (12-4, Super Bowl loser) – While QB Ben Roethlisberger sat out the first four games with suspension, the NFL’s best defense by far kept Pittsburgh 3-1. Then Roethlisberger starred with high-completion, low-interception passing. RB Rashard Mendenhall ran for 1,273 yards and 13 TDs. WR Mike Wallace gained 1,257 yards at 21 yards per catch, with 10 TDs. All Pros Troy Polamalu and James Harrison made the defense dominant.
